#a0e960 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a0e960 is composed of 62.7% red, 91.4%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 92 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 64.5%. #a0e960 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#41d300.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#a0e960 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a0e960 has RGB values of R:160, G:233,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 10545504.

Hex triplet a0e960 #a0e960
RGB Decimal 160, 233, 96 rgb(160,233,96)
RGB Percent 62.7, 91.4, 37.6 rgb(62.7%,91.4%,37.6%)
CMYK 31, 0, 59, 9
HSL 92°, 75.7, 64.5 hsl(92,75.7%,64.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 92°, 58.8, 91.4
Web Safe 99ff66 #99ff66
CIE-LAB 85.299, -44.792, 58.172
XYZ 45.746, 66.594, 21.509
xyY 0.342, 0.498, 66.594
CIE-LCH 85.299, 73.419, 127.596
CIE-LUV 85.299, -36.447, 79.853
Hunter-Lab 81.605, -42.746, 41.496
Binary 10100000, 11101001, 01100000

Shades and Tints of #a0e960

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0e960

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4aa9f is the less saturated color, while #9ffe4b is the most saturated one.
